From Tereshkin’s perspective, the market needs new solutions that extend beyond export bans or reconsideration of the damping payment rules (compensations from the budget to oil companies for supplying fuel to the domestic market at prices lower than exports). Companies and regulators find themselves in a closed loop. On one hand, this ensures predictability, as companies clearly understand the boundaries of allowed actions. On the other hand, it distances the resolution of the price growth problem, which car owners face ...

... easier to own. Similarly, easier access to Bitcoin via familiar financial channels is expected to fuel upward price pressure on the cryptocurrency. Bitcoin’s market liquidity stands to improve as well. ETFs allow investors to trade Bitcoin exposure on regulated stock exchanges. Higher trading volumes on these exchanges mean more efficient price discovery and less reliance on volatile crypto exchanges. Greater liquidity can also reduce price swings, as large transactions will have a smaller impact when markets are deeper. Moreover, as banks integrate Bitcoin ETFs, the supporting infrastructure ...

... European prices are currently significantly lower than the crisis peaks of 2022; however, any supply disruptions or an early onset of cold weather in the fall may again increase volatility. Record-high storage volumes reduce the likelihood of sharp price spikes this winter, which is positively perceived by investors and industrial consumers. Market participants are closely monitoring further steps by the EU to strengthen energy security—including discussions on new storage filling regulations and potential restrictions on Russian gas imports. ... in March 2023 when USD Coin temporarily lost its peg to the dollar (dropping to ~$0.88) following news of the bankruptcy of Silicon Valley Bank, where a portion of Circle's reserves was held. However, after guarantees of deposit insurance from U.S. regulators, the price quickly recovered. This situation highlighted both the risks of stablecoins (dependence on the banking system) and the market's ability for self-regulation.
